  1. Macon City Auditorium: Macon, GA 2/11/72 is a two-CD live album by the Allman Brothers Band. It was recorded at the Macon City Auditorium in Macon, Georgia on February 11, 1972. The third archival concert album from the Allman Brothers Band Recording Company, it was released in 2004.

  4. Macon City Auditorium 2/11/72. Release Month. 1. Release Year. 2004. Two CD set. The third Allman Brothers archival release, and perhaps the most poignant one. Recorded in Macon, GA in February 1972, these CDs present the unified front that was the five-man version of the band as it gamely carried on following the loss of Duane Allman.
